Description

Ruegeria halocynthiae is a Gram-negative, rod-shaped bacterium that exhibits optimal growth at a temperature of 29.0°C. This microbe is part of the diverse microbial community found in marine environments, where it may play a role in the complex interactions among marine organisms. The classification as Gram-negative suggests that Ruegeria halocynthiae possesses a thinner peptidoglycan layer and an outer membrane containing lipopolysaccharides, which can influence its interactions within the marine ecosystem. The rod shape of Ruegeria halocynthiae is characteristic of many bacteria, allowing for efficient nutrient uptake and motility in aquatic environments.
